Subject: SQL lint cut-over complete

Hi Marenka,

The cut-over to the new Quillcheck linting rules for SQL files finished this morning. All repositories under the Tidewell platform now enforce keyword casing, mandatory table aliases, and the ban on implicit joins. Legacy migration files are exempted via the grandfather list. CI failures dropped back to baseline after the first hour. For your records, the linter now runs with the following configuration.

settings of baweg-tadup:
[julwyn]
host = julwyn.novacdata.internal
user = julwyn_svc
database = julwyn_prod

## Environments: payload compression for Tinwhistle telemetry

Quick note for the release manager: staging runs zstd compression on telemetry payloads, prod is still gzip until the collector fleet upgrade lands. Don't promote a build that assumes zstd everywhere — the Harglow collectors will choke. The effective settings for the staging tier are listed below.

config for yajep-tafof:
[rusath]
team = julmir
access_code = ac_fe37fd
host = rusath.novactech.test
port = 8000
owner = pelmir.weneth
peer = oliwyn.olvarqdyn.internal

## Step 4: Point your plugin at the new tour database

Heads up, plugin folks: as of Whisperstop 3.0, the audio-guide app no longer bundles the gallery tour data locally. Your plugin should read stops, transcripts, and beacon mappings straight from the shared tour store instead of the old JSON cache. Delete any `tours.json` your plugin shipped with. For local testing against the sandbox museum dataset, use the following connection string.

primary connection of yagep-kahip = redis://giliel_svc:zYiKsLL2PLpfPL@db-348f.xolmarsys.corp:5432/fenwyn

## Deploying the Gatewick Proctor Queue

Deploys are pretty painless: push to main, wait for the pipeline, then watch the queue drain dashboard for five minutes. If candidates pile up mid-exam, roll back first and ask questions later — the queue replays safely. Everything the workers care about lives in one config block, shown here for reference.

settings of bafof-yagef:
JOROX_PIN=8740
JOROX_TENANT=pelox
JOROX_METRICS_HOST=metrics.jorox.qorvelworks.internal
JOROX_SEAL=seal_c78f63c1
JOROX_STANDBY_TEAM=norax